Skip to content

Is the 'deployReleaseBinaries' CI build step supposed to run the unit tests 3 times? #781

@Numpsy

Description

@Numpsy

This is just an observation after looking at the current build issues rather than a bug, but I'm putting it in its own issue rather than just in a comment in an unrelated PR:

Looking at the CI build logs, it looks like the deployReleaseBinaries CI stage is running the unit tests 3 times -

Once in the 'build' step - https://github.com/fsprojects/FSharpLint/actions/runs/19330699804/job/55293390736#step:4:55
Then again in the 'pack' step - https://github.com/fsprojects/FSharpLint/actions/runs/19330699804/job/55293390736#step:5:68
Then a 3rd time in the 'upload binaries to nuget' step - https://github.com/fsprojects/FSharpLint/actions/runs/19330699804/job/55293390736#step:8:64

This seems a tad spurious, and also looks like it adds several minutes to the build times?

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ions